Who we are.

Founded in 1987 by Barry F. Lorenzetti, BFL CANADA is one of the largest employee-owned and operated Risk Management, Insurance Brokerage, and Employee Benefits consulting services firms in North America. The firm has a team of 1300 professionals located in 26 offices across the country. Our employees have free rein to demonstrate their creativity, leadership, and entrepreneurial skills since we believe in each one of them. BFL CANADA is a founding Partner of Lockton Global LLP, a partnership of independent insurance brokers who provide Risk Management, Insurance and Benefits Consulting services in over 140 countries around the world.
